MetaMask(メタマスク)でガス代の安い時間帯を狙う方法
ブロックチェーン技術の進展に伴い、仮想通貨やデジタル資産の取引は日常的な活動へと変化しつつあります。特に、イーサリアム(Ethereum)ネットワーク上でのトランザクションは、スマートコントラクトの実行や非代替性トークン(NFT)の購入など、さまざまな用途に使われています。しかし、これらの操作には「ガス代」と呼ばれる手数料が必要であり、これがユーザーにとって負担となる場合があります。本記事では、MetaMaskという人気のあるウォレットツールを活用し、ガス代が安くなる時間帯を正確に把握・利用するための戦略について、専門的な視点から詳細に解説します。
ガス代とは何か?
ガス代は、イーサリアムネットワーク上でトランザクションを処理するために支払われる手数料です。この仕組みは、ネットワーク上のマイナー(検証者)に対して、計算リソースの使用に対する報酬として機能しています。ガス代の金額は、トランザクションの複雑さ(例:スマートコントラクトの実行回数)、ネットワークの混雑状況、そしてユーザーが設定するガスプライス(Gas Price)によって決定されます。
ガス代の単位は「Gwei」で表され、1 Gwei = 10⁻⁹ イーサ(ETH)。例えば、あるトランザクションのガス消費量が21,000ガス、ガスプライスが50 Gweiの場合、合計ガス代は 21,000 × 50 = 1,050,000 Gwei(=0.00105 ETH)となります。このように、小さな差異でも合計コストに大きな影響を与えるため、効率的なガス代管理は非常に重要です。
なぜガス代は時間帯によって変動するのか?
ガス代の価格は、常に一定ではなく、時間帯ごとに大きく変動します。その主な理由は、ネットワークの需要と供給のバランスにあります。イーサリアムネットワークでは、各ブロックに含まれるトランザクション数に上限があり(現在は約15万ガス/ブロック)、多くのユーザーが同時にトランザクションを送信すると、ブロック内のスペースが不足し、競争が発生します。その結果、ユーザーはより高いガスプライスを提示することで、自分のトランザクションが優先的に処理されるようになります。
そのため、多くの人が集中して行動する時間帯(例:昼間の仕事帰り、週末の夕方など)は、ガス代が急騰します。逆に、深夜や早朝、または長期休暇期間中など、ユーザーの活動が極めて少ない時間帯は、ガス代が著しく低くなる傾向があります。このような時間帯を的確に捉えることで、コストを大幅に削減することが可能になります。
MetaMaskを用いたガス代のリアルタイム監視
MetaMaskは、イーサリアムネットワークにアクセスする際の主要なウェブウォレットであり、ユーザーインターフェースが直感的で使いやすく、多くのデジタル資産取引に不可欠なツールです。このウォレットは、ガス代の見積もり機能を内蔵しており、トランザクションを送信する前に、推定ガス代を表示します。
MetaMaskの設定画面から「ガス代(Gas Fee)」の項目を確認すると、3つの選択肢が表示されます:
- 高速(Fast):即時処理が期待できるが、ガス代が最も高くなる。
- 標準(Standard):平均的な処理時間(数分以内)で、バランスの取れたコスト。
- 低速(Slow):処理時間が長くなるが、ガス代が最小限に抑えられる。
この設定により、ユーザーは自身のニーズに応じて最適なガスプライスを選択できます。
ポイント: MetaMaskは、自動的にネットワークの最新状況に基づいて推奨ガス代を提示しますが、ユーザーが「カスタムガス代」を設定することで、より細かい調整が可能です。特に、ガス代の安い時間帯に合わせて低めのガスプライスを設定すると、費用を劇的に削減できます。
ガス代が安い時間帯を特定するための調査手法
ガス代が安い時間帯を見極めるには、過去のデータ分析と継続的なモニタリングが不可欠です。以下に、実践的なアプローチを紹介します。
1. ネットワークトラフィックの可視化ツールの活用
「Etherscan」や「EthGasWatch」などの専門サイトは、イーサリアムネットワークのガス代の履歴データをリアルタイムで提供しています。これらのプラットフォームでは、以下の情報を確認できます:
- 過去24時間の平均ガス代(Gwei単位)
- 各時間帯におけるガス代の推移グラフ
- ブロック生成速度とトランザクション件数の関係
- 「High Priority」、「Medium」、「Low Priority」のトランザクション比率
これらのデータを分析することで、通常のピーク時刻(例:日本時間の午前10時~午後6時)と、谷底となる時間帯(例:日本時間の午前2時~午前5時)を明確に把握できます。
2. 時間帯別の統計パターンの把握
経験則として、以下のような時間帯がガス代が低い傾向にあります:
- 日本時間の午前2時~午前5時:世界中の主要な金融市場が閉鎖している深夜帯。特に欧米のユーザーが活動を停止しているため、ネットワーク負荷が最低レベルに低下。
- 土曜日の午前~午後12時頃:週末の初めであり、多くのユーザーが個人的な取引や投資活動を控えている時期。ただし、NFT落札やゲームイベントなどがある場合は例外あり。
- 祝日・年末年始・夏休み期間:社会全体の活動が減少するため、ガス代が一時的に大幅に下がる傾向がある。
これらを定期的に観察することで、長期的に安定した低コスト運用が可能になります。
MetaMaskでの実践的なガス代節約戦略
理論的な知識だけではなく、実際にどのように行動すべきかが重要です。以下は、MetaMaskを活用した具体的な節約方法です。
1. 予約送信(Scheduled Transactions)の活用
MetaMask自体は直接のスケジューリング機能を備えていませんが、外部サービス(例:「Rainbow」や「Zapper.fi」)と連携することで、特定の時間にトランザクションを自動送信することが可能です。例えば、深夜2時に自動的にガス代が低い状態でスマートコントラクトの実行を開始するといった運用が可能です。
2. ガスプライスのカスタム設定
MetaMaskの「カスタムガス代」機能を使えば、希望するガスプライス(Gwei)を手動で入力できます。ガス代が安い時間帯であれば、5〜10 Gwei程度で十分な場合もあります。ただし、あまりに低すぎると処理が遅延する可能性があるため、適切な範囲(例:8~15 Gwei)を設定することが推奨されます。
3. バッチ処理による効率化
複数のトランザクション(例:複数のNFT購入、複数のステーキング操作)を一度にまとめて処理する「バッチ処理」を行うことで、1回のガス代で複数の操作が完了します。これにより、トランザクションあたりのコストを相対的に低く抑えることが可能になります。
注意点: ガス代を極端に低く設定しすぎると、ネットワークが処理を無視する可能性があります。これは「ガス不足」または「トランザクション失敗」となり、再送信が必要になるため、コスト逆効果を引き起こすことがあります。最適なバランスを保つことが鍵です。
ガス代の安い時間帯を狙うための準備と習慣化
ガス代の節約は、一度きりの努力ではなく、継続的な習慣として身につけるべきものです。以下のようなルーティンを導入することで、長期的に安定したコスト管理が実現します。
- 毎日午前6時と午後18時に、EtherscanやEthGasWatchでガス代の状況をチェック。
- 週末には、翌週のガス代推移を予測し、重要な取引を深夜帯にスケジュール。
- MetaMaskの「ガス代の通知」機能を有効にし、低価格帯のタイミングを知らせる。
- 取引記録をノートやエクセルで管理し、どの時間帯にどれだけのコストで取引を行ったかを可視化。
こうした習慣を繰り返すことで、自然と「ガス代が安い時間帯」を意識するようになり、結果としてコストの無駄を徹底的に排除できます。
まとめ
本稿では、MetaMaskを活用してガス代の安い時間帯を狙う方法について、理論的背景から実践的な戦略まで、多角的に解説しました。ガス代は、イーサリアムネットワークの基本的な仕組みであるとともに、ユーザーの経済的負担ともなるため、それを賢く管理することは、デジタル資産の効率的運用において不可欠です。
重要なのは、ガス代の変動要因を理解し、時間帯のパターンを観察すること。また、MetaMaskのカスタム設定や外部ツールとの連携を通じて、適切なタイミングで低コストのトランザクションを実行することです。さらに、継続的なデータ収集と習慣化によって、ガス代の節約は単なる偶然ではなく、確実な成果に結びつきます。
今後のブロックチェーン環境においても、ガス代の最適化は依然として重要な課題です。本記事で紹介した方法を活用することで、ユーザーはより安心かつ経済的な取引環境を構築でき、持続可能なデジタル資産運用を実現することができます。



